Suitable for mounting pictures and posters as well as small electronics like a GPS, the 3M Scotch® Fasteners are ideal for organizing homes, offices, cars and more. The interlocking tape has a permanent adhesive on the back for a secure grip. They are ideal for indoor and outdoor use.
Details:
- Black
- 2" x 3"
- Holds up to 3 lbs. (1 lb. per 1")
- Lasts up to 10,000 closures
- Easy-to-apply design with no mess or tools
- Liner peels back to expose strong adhesive
